About the role
Nelson Mullins, an Am Law 100 firm, is seeking a Litigation Administrative Assistant to join our collaborative team in our San Diego office. In this role, you’ll play a key part in supporting attorneys and paralegals on a variety of complex commercial, civil, and defense litigation matters.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ced professional to provide high-level legal and administrative support while working alongside talented colleagues in a dynamic and supportive environment.
Responsibilities
- Maintain attorney calendars, make travel arrangements, and process monthly expense reports
- Prepare, revise, and finalize correspondence, pleadings, and other legal documents, as well as perform electronic filing (e-filing) in various courts and jurisdictions
- Schedule depositions, mediations, and other client meetings, and communicate with clients as necessary
- Run conflict checks, open new client/matter engagements, maintain electronic files, set up billing requirements for clients, maintain and update contacts, assist with billing and client invoices, and handle other clerical assignments as delegated
Requirements
- At least four years of recent State and Federal litigation experience in a law firm environment
- Proactive, self-starting professional with strong writing and communication skills
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ite, and experience with document management systems, docketing systems, and billing or time entry programs is preferred
